Belgium Friday quotes: Toyota

Jarno Trulli - 7th: "It was a good Friday for us. Obviously there is still work to do to get the most out of the car and I need to find a bit more grip at the rear end but all in all I am very happy with the results today. I have a good feeling from the car so I hope it will be a competitive weekend for us. The track was wet this morning which meant we couldn't do all of the tests we had planned but we did some laps to better understand the car in those conditions. In the afternoon, when it was dry, the track just got quicker and quicker. I was working mainly on race pace today, getting the car set-up in race trim so we have a good balance for Sunday, and it seems to be reacting well."

Timo Glock - 2nd: "Whenever you come back to Spa it is a nice experience to do your first laps of the weekend and that was the case again today. It's a great circuit and very satisfying for a driver, especially when you have a competitive car. It's hard to draw any conclusions from the wet session this morning but I am pleased to be second in the afternoon; that is very encouraging. The car felt pretty good and the lap times show that. Still, there are a couple of areas to improve so we will work on those before qualifying and try to find the perfect aerodynamic balance. I am happy with how things went today and I'm interested to see where we are tomorrow."

Dieter Gass, Chief Engineer Race and Test: "Overall it has been a positive day for us. It was a bit unfortunate that the first session was disrupted by wet conditions because dry weather is forecast for the rest of the weekend, so we lost some time to work on the car. In the afternoon we were mainly concentrating on assessing the revised aerodynamic package we have brought to this race. We also looked at the tyres and both specifications seem to be behaving okay. We anticipated some warm-up issues but that doesn't seem to be the case. In general we are quite happy with what we have seen so far so we are looking forward with optimism to the rest of the weekend."
